Bitcoin Insights Today

-Macroeconomic Caution: Investors are heavily de-risking and rotating out of crypto assets ahead of the U.S. Consumer Price Index (CPI) inflation report dropping tomorrow. Expected sticky inflation signals could prompt the Federal Reserve to keep interest rates locked high at 3.50%–3.75%, maintaining macro headwinds for non-yielding assets like crypto.

-Strait of Hormuz Stalemate: Geopolitical tensions surged after President Trump demanded 50 years of compensation from Iran to reopen the critical shipping lane. The resulting stalemate pushed Brent crude oil up past $89, fueling energy-driven inflation fears that triggered broad liquidations in risk assets, including Bitcoin.

-Institutional Selling Pressure: Pressure compounded as MicroStrategy disclosed yet another weekly reduction, selling 1,690 BTC for $109 million. This marks their fifth major multi-million dollar Bitcoin offload this year. Additionally, institutional sentiment cooled with $144 million in spot Bitcoin ETF outflows recorded on Monday alone.

-Global Regulation Shift: In a major regulatory pivot, Russia's Central Bank officially approved Bitcoin and Ethereum for exchange trading. While retail investors face a strict 300,000-ruble annual cap per intermediary and mandatory risk testing, qualified institutional traders face no restrictions.
